Here are some tips from the Mayo Clinic for healthy eating: Eat out no more than once a week; avoid processed foods; eat fresh or organic, non-GMO foods when possible; and eat with someone — dinners with family and friends encourage community.

Good information but it’s not like we are unaware of how to be healthy — and stay healthy — it’s just not always easy to stick to those rules.

It doesn’t hurt to be reminded.
